Transaction 25eb4a5e06ac2490ca4c7aab27af45a736d6c1c7d8316ae4138c49904ce9be1a

1 Input
2 Outputs
  • 25eb4a5e06ac2490ca4c7aab27af45a736d6c1c7d8316ae4138c49904ce9be1a:0
  • value  2648339
    address  3BBjK4rH7HDf2us2NCMzbADKf6fjKBqZHi
  • 25eb4a5e06ac2490ca4c7aab27af45a736d6c1c7d8316ae4138c49904ce9be1a:1
  • value  70946757
    address  35iMHbUZeTssxBodiHwEEkb32jpBfVueEL